What is an excellent administrator?

An excellent school administrator is an instructional leader with strong ethics, dynamic personality, and unyielding commitment to students. An excellent administrator empowers others to accomplish their responsibilities in a manner, which enhances the individual and collective growth of the school population.

What is the most important skill of an admin and why?

Verbal & Written Communication One of the most important administrative skills you can exhibit as an admin assistant are your communication abilities. The company needs to know they can trust you to be the face and voice of other employees and even the company.

What makes a good administrator in an organization?

Taking responsibility for meeting deadlines and checking information helps to ensure that nothing is missed and nobody is let down. Interpersonal skills such as verbal communication, problem-solving and listening skills are essential in an administrative role.

What kind of skills are needed for an administrative role?

Computing: maintaining records and tracking project progress would require a working knowledge in computer software packages like the Microsoft Office and any other form of technology that helps you work efficiently.
